Jordan's foreign reserves have reached a new record high, totaling $21.116 billion by the end of January 2025.
According to data from the Central Bank of Jordan, this increase in foreign reserves has extended the coverage period for Jordan’s imports of goods and services to 8.3 months.

This milestone reflects the country's strong financial position and contributes to enhancing its ability to meet external financial obligations, providing a buffer against economic fluctuations.
